Mary Beth McGreevy wrote:
Can Openoffice be used with Vista? I downloaded Openoffice, but I cannot enter
information in the word processing or spreadsheets.
Yes, it is compatible with Vista and many Vista users have installed it.
The procedure for installing OpenOffice is to download the latest
Windows version from www.openoffice.org. Then double click on the
downloaded file. This will start the installation process that takes
you through a few configuration panels, where you can generally use the
default values. When the installation is complete, you should have an
OpenOffice folder & icons in your Start menu. You can then use the
icons to start the various OpenOffice components. If you have done
this and are still having problems, please describe what you are doing
and results, including any error messages.
